Liza Creel PhDThe Economic Analysis Core provides ACCORDS investigators and other researchers on the CU Anschutz Medical Campus with consultation services about incorporating an economic component into their projects. This will allow researchers to address implementation, dissemination, and sustainability, which are issues of growing interest to funders.
Provide consultation services during the project planning and proposal stages to support “designing for sustainability from multiple perspectives” and contribute to funded projects in four areas of economic analysis.
The Economic Analysis Core is an extension of the Data Science to Patient Value (D2V) – Patient and System Value Core with ACCORDS collaborations. The Economic Analysis Core will continue to support the resource hub developed by the Patient and System Value Core, which provides resources to support time-driven activity-based costing methods (TDABC).
